What is Chinese Yuan (CNY)

The Chinese Yuan, officially known as Renminbi (RMB), is the currency of the People's Republic of China. The symbol for the Yuan is ¥, and its code is CNY. The Yuan plays a significant role in the global economy, as China is one of the largest trading nations in the world.

The currency is subdivided into smaller units called jiao, with 1 Yuan equal to 10 jiao. The value of CNY can fluctuate based on various factors, including economic performance, government policies, and foreign exchange reserves. In recent years, the Chinese government has taken steps to promote the Yuan in international markets, aiming for more countries to use CNY in trade and financial transactions.

When converting CNY to other currencies, including the Zambian Kwacha, it is essential to be aware of the current exchange rates, as they can change frequently due to market conditions. The value of Yuan can also be influenced by the economic relationship between China and other countries, including Zambia, which is primarily driven by trade agreements and investment projects.

What is Zambian Kwacha (ZMW)

The Zambian Kwacha is the official currency of Zambia, a country located in Southern Africa. The currency symbol for Kwacha is K, and its code is ZMW. The Kwacha was first introduced in 1968, replacing the Zambian pound at a rate of 1 Kwacha to 2 pounds. The term "Kwacha" means "dawn" in the local Nyanja language, symbolizing the country's independence and the bright future ahead.

The Zambian economy is primarily based on mining, agriculture, and tourism. Copper mining is one of the most critical sectors, significantly contributing to the country’s GDP and foreign exchange earnings. As a result, the value of the Kwacha is often influenced by global copper prices, trade balances, and overall economic performance.

Just like the Yuan, the Kwacha's exchange rate against other currencies, including CNY, can be affected by various factors such as inflation, interest rates, and foreign direct investment. Understanding these influences is crucial when exchanging the Zambian Kwacha for Chinese Yuan or any other currency.
